And just last Tuesday, I headed over to West Elm Broadway for a good cause.

I stopped in to decorate some paper hearts. You see, West Elm has this dream of making the longest paper heart chain. And for each heart made, $1 will be donated to St. Jude Children's Research Hospital. All the more reason to craft, right?
